    Description

    This freeware module is intended to be used with CowanSim H-125 helicopter as a realism enhancement mod.

    List of features:

    • *NEW* MSFS2024 Flight Model
    • Realistic AS350/H125 Vortex Ring State (VRS) model
    • Loss of Tail-rotor Effectiveness (LTE) model
    • Retreating Blade Stall (RBS) model
    • Custom engine temperature (T4) and engine hotstart modelling
    • Realistic H125 Hydraulic system including Servo Transparency phenomenon
    • Stress damage model on different helicopter components: engine, main rotor and tail rotor transmission
    • Random failures model system based on realistic aviation failure rates: engine fail, oil leak, main rotor failure, tail rotor servo stuck, etc.
    • Engine / blades icing effects 
    • ...and many other additions & fixes! (check version readme)

    Version History

    v8.0: - Servo Transparency effect restored. Accidentally it was disabled in previous versions - Collective filtering action implemented in MSFS2024 resulting in an overall smoother rotor response and helicopter control - Collective filtering configurable (see UserGuide) - SAS algorithms improved for FFB devices - DHM sound pack v0.9.6 updated : + ADV custom sounds removed as already implemented by DHM (thanks!) + ADV Fire sound removed as not present in the real helo + Doors & internal sounds interaction improved + Piston engine starter sound with open doors fixed - Updated UserGuide (please, do read!) NOTES: (1) Rebuild the layout.json files in the mod folders after installation (2) The SAS is not interfered -at all- with this mod and "sas_improved_ffb = 0" in the H125_realism.cfg.
